Foremost on behalf of the children and the First Love Foundation, we wish to express our most sincere gratitude for your kind support for the children of Sangrur, situated in the Punjab State of India. This project sought to facilitate elementary education and a feeding program for destitute children from a slum colony in Sangrur.
As of the previous report, the donations made through GlobalGiving were utilised to facilitate the slum children of various ages for their very first term of school. This was a major achievement as these children of various ages were attending formal school for the first time ever, thankfully because of your kind donations. Their transition to formal school did not go as smoothly as expected as the children were not received well by the other students. It would be more practical for these children to attend formal school in an environment that is more accepting of them. However, this is as much as we could do in this regard.
We wish to inform you our supporters, that this project will be moving to Madhya Pradesh state, specifically to Bhopal and Jabalpur. The state has a special place in my heart, as I spent there about 7 years at university, from the young age of 19 years. In line with this and considering the love with which the people of Madhya Pradesh took care of me as a student, we have agreed as an organisation to transition and focus our support on a couple of projects in that state to provide access to education for destitute boys and girls.
